Web28 de abr. de 2024 · Oogenesis is the process of development of female gametes (also called ova or eggs), that takes place in ovaries. The process of oogenesis begins before birth and then development is suspended until puberty. Development resumes with ovulation and the final step (meiosis II) is completed only if fertilization occurs. Our analyses led to the identification of 97,383 … Web28 de mai. de 2024 · Oogenesis occurs in the outermost layers of the ovaries. As with sperm production, oogenesis starts with a germ cell, called an oogonium (plural: oogonia), but this cell undergoes mitosis to increase in number, eventually resulting in up to one to two million cells in the embryo.
